Getting for you to the decision of which legal entity to choose, let's take each one separately. The most frequent form of legal entity is tag heuer. There are two basic forms, C Corp and S Corp. A C Corp pays tax produced from its profit for 2011 and then any dividends paid to shareholders is also taxed. Hence the term double-taxation. An S Corp however works differently. The S Corp pays no tax on profits. The net income flows through which the shareholders who then pay tax on cash. The big difference yet another excellent that the 15.3% self-employment tax does not apply. So, by forming an S Corporation, company saves $3,060 for the year just passed on a fortune of $20,000. The income tax still applies, but I am sure someone like better to pay $1,099 than $4,159. That has become a savings.
